Then I do think, too, and once more, I don’t understand how you take care of it, but being familiar with in which to allocate budgeting bucks, wherever I see a lot of tiny business people make this mistake. Effectively, they’ll head out and expend lots of money on a different Internet site and assume that their Web-site developer is aware the best way to do Search engine marketing. They are saying, Oh, yeah, I paid out $5,000, $ten,000, $fifteen,000 for my Internet site. It’s received to generally be great on Web optimization. Which’s not the case. And so they may be greater off creating a smaller sized Internet site, decrease funds on the web site, and choosing gurus, no matter whether it’s Search engine marketing or Google Ads execs or social media marketing Adverts professionals To place fuel within the tank of that Web page to acquire it to complete also to do the point that they want it to accomplish, that's created.


For lesser regional companies, it will become very crucial, right? So Exactly what are a number of the normally there ignored components inside of a GPP listing that new organizations can improve to raise the chance of very poor inquiries and have their cellphone ringing?


What we contact it can be fill-in-the-blank Website positioning.


That is exciting.


So lots of companies that we’ve witnessed, they go and they are saying, Oh, what’s this Google business enterprise profile? Plus they go they usually determine how to set up their Google company profile. And afterwards check with you, What’s your online business identify? What’s your What’s your phone number? What’s your service region? They get everything finished. With any luck ,, they get it verified, which may be a true problem in and of by itself. They say, All right, I’ve obtained a Google business enterprise profile now. Factors are very good. They’ve never ever really taken some time either by themselves or to hire a person to return via that profile and fill from the blanks. What's your service place? Do you've proper support parts? That stuff. Is your site URL suitable? Yeah. Did you fill in all of the blanks where you can place it in a web site URL? Enable’s say you put in the appointment backlink in your Google business enterprise profile. Does that allow you to rank improved? I’m not sure. Will it change much better? Unquestionably. Whenever you can spot a link on an asset after some time, you will get conversions from that. Yet again, from the standpoint of, why do you've got a Google business enterprise profile in the first place?

To produce sales opportunities? Enable’s make certain your profile is about approximately crank out potential customers, and after that we are able to improve the visibility in them. For us, at the least, we glance with the lens of authority, relevance, and have faith in. In case you ended up Google, would you exhibit this Google small business profile to people today? Then you take a look at what everybody else is accomplishing. Hey, the persons displaying up now have 30, forty, 50 photos in there. We've got three. Enable’s set some far more images in there and see if we can get well engagement, see if that might help us get visibility. At that point, it’s just figuring it out, genuinely, and endeavoring to do things which are going to Offer you far more authority, relevance, and trust in Google.
